Preparing for Contact with Customer Support
To ensure a smooth and efficient customer service experience, take a few moments to prepare before contacting Aegis. Have your policy number handy, as this will be the first thing the customer service representative asks for. Write down a clear and concise explanation of your issue, and gather any relevant documents or information that may be helpful. Take notes during the call, including the date, time, representative’s name, and any confirmation numbers provided. This will help you track the progress of your inquiry and avoid any confusion later on. Being prepared for your call will help you communicate effectively and resolve your issue more quickly.

Contacting Support via Email
Some insurance companies offer email support for general inquiries or less urgent matters. Check the Aegis website for a customer service email address or a contact form you can use to submit your questions or concerns. When sending an email, be sure to include your policy number, a clear explanation of your issue, and your contact information. Keep in mind that email response times may be longer than phone support, so this method is best suited for non-urgent matters. Email support can be a convenient option for submitting documentation, asking clarifying questions, or following up on previous inquiries. Always be professional in your email and include all pertinent information to assist the service team in resolving your questions.

Identity Verification Protocols
Be prepared to verify your identity when contacting Aegis. This is a standard security measure to protect your privacy and prevent unauthorized access to your account. The customer service representative may ask for your name, address, date of birth, or other personal information to verify your identity. Be prepared to answer these questions accurately and honestly. Verifying your identity helps ensure that your personal information is protected and that only authorized individuals can access your account. This also protects Aegis from fraudulent claims and ensures only legitimate policyholders receive assistance.
